The Middle Class of Creators

The influencer marketing factory report via Newswire.com indicates the rise of a 'creator middle class.' This demographic comprises creators who, while not at the top tier, are earning sustainable incomes through diversified revenue streams. This trend underscores the importance of building a robust portfolio of income sources, including brand partnerships, subscriptions, and merchandise sales.

Data-Driven Insights

To navigate the creator economy effectively, understanding key data points is essential. Here’s a snapshot of creator economy statistics:

MetricValue
Total Market Size (2034)$1,072.8B
Growth Rate (2023-2034)14% CAGR
Percentage of Middle-Class Creators30%
AI Utilization Rate by Creators65%

These figures highlight the rapid growth and evolving dynamics of the field, emphasizing the need for creators to remain adaptable and data-informed.

Strategies for Success

  1. Diversify Income Streams: Relying solely on ad revenue or sponsorships is risky. Explore subscriptions, merchandise, and exclusive content.
  2. Leverage AI Tools: Incorporate AI for content creation and management to save time and enhance content quality.
  3. Focus on Community: Build and nurture a community that shares your values and interests, fostering deeper connections.
  4. Stay Informed: Keep abreast of market trends and data to make informed decisions and adapt strategies accordingly.
